Barratt offers three year price guarantee

The way it works is simple. If you want to sell your house within three years and the value is lower than what you paid for it, Barratt will refund the difference up to a maximum of 15 per cent.
In other words, even if house prices fall 15 per cent by 2011, you won't be out of pocket.

Dave Hodgson, Sales Director at Barratt Manchester, said: "We know that many people want to buy a new home at the moment but are being put off by what they read about house prices.
"So we looked at what we could do to help and are offering to guarantee the price of their new home. It hugely reduces the risk and means that people who felt they would have to put off buying for a few years now have the option of moving straightaway.
"Customers who buy one of our homes with a price guarantee will only need a mortgage for 85 per cent of its value. That's because we'll give them a deferred loan for the rest and they can pay us back when they can afford it up to 10yrs upon completion. It all adds up to a big helping hand for buyers."
